Course Content

• International Trade Law and Regulations
• Negotiation Strategies and Tactics in International Trade
• Cross-Cultural Communication and Negotiation
• International Trade Finance and Risk Management
• Dispute Resolution in International Trade
• Global Supply Chain Management and Logistics
• International Trade Agreements and Policy
• International Trade Negotiation Management: Case Studies
• Ethical Considerations in International Business Negotiations
